Key Developments

AI-powered security platforms analyze billions of events daily —
network traffic, user behavior, device health, and application activity —
to identify anomalies in real time.

Instead of relying on static rules, these systems learn normal behavior
and immediately flag deviations, often stopping attacks
before human analysts are even aware.

Zero Trust architectures are being adopted widely,
requiring verification at every access point,
regardless of whether the request originates inside or outside the network.

Challenges & Ethical Concerns

AI-powered surveillance raises privacy concerns.
Continuous monitoring must be balanced with civil liberties
and transparent governance.

There is also the risk of over-reliance.
Security teams must ensure that human judgment
remains central to incident response and accountability.
